Where to Buy RPL Coin? Inventory of RPL Coin Trading Platforms
RPL (Rocket Pool) is a decentralized staking service that allows cryptocurrency users to stake their ETH on Ethereum 2.0. RPL tokens are the utility tokens of the Rocket Pool platform, used for various purposes such as collateral, fees, and governance.

- Fees: Compare the trading fees and network fees of different platforms to choose the most cost-effective option.
- Liquidity: Choose a platform that offers high liquidity to ensure that you can execute your trades quickly and efficiently.
- Security: Select a platform with strong security measures, such as 2-factor authentication and wallet insurance.
- Support: Consider the level of customer support offered by the platform to ensure that you can resolve any issues or inquiries promptly.
- Token availability: Verify that the platform you choose supports trading of RPL coins.
